типы php как объекты

 

 

 

 

В программирования на языке PHP, как и в любом другом, для правильной работы программы, интерпретатор должен понимать какой тип имеет та или иная переменная.Объект (object) - об этом типе будет рассказано в главе ООП. Типы данных PHP. PHP: Булев (boolean) - логический тип. PHP: Integer - целое число. PHP: float/double - числo с плавающей точкой.PHP: Классы и объекты. В этой главе: Определение класса. Создание объекта . Создание объектов в PHP. Вы можете создать объект класса с помощью ключевого слова new, следующим образомТеперь, когда мы знаем, как создавать классы и объекты PHP, давайте рассмотрим добавление свойств. Существует 3 типа свойств, которые можно добавить в класс Что такое объекты и где их использовать? Слово это сложное,на первый взглядкажется что это дебри неизведанного и сложного ООП,что-то сродни инкапсуляции или полиморфизму.ооп. Статьи по теме. Объекты php. Объекты. В одной из первых лекций мы упоминали о существовании в PHP такого типа данных, как объект. Класс это описание данных одного типа, данных типа объект.

Объекты. В одной из первых лекций мы упоминали о существовании в PHP такого типа данных, как объект. Класс это описание данных одного типа, данных типа объект. Объекты. Объект - это переменная специального типа, которая создается через класс. Он содержит действительные данные и функции для манипулирования ими.Как создавать объекты в PHP? Создать объект можно с помощью ключевого слова new Типы PHP PHP поддерживает 8 примитивных типов.4 скалярных типа:booleanintegerчисло с плавающей точкой (float)stringДва составных типа:arrayobjectИ, наконец два специальных типа:resourc. Я знаю isobject() чтобы проверить, является ли аргумент объектом, но я хочу проверить, является ли pdo объектом PDO, а не только объектом.Solutions Collecting From Web of "Как проверить конкретный тип объекта в PHP". Объекты как ссылки.

Как вам уже наверняка известно, в PHP4 переменные передаются в функции/методы по значениюУказание типов для аргументов. В PHP5 вы сможете "сказать" методу, что он должен получить в качестве аргумента объект определённого типа. PHP Object - объект. Object - тип данных, который хранит данные и информацию о том, как обрабатывать эти данные. В PHP, объект должен быть объявлены точно. Сначала мы должны объявить класс объекта. Объекты — это и есть утки. Тип создаваемых объектов определяется формой отливки.Каждому объекту, создаваемому в PHP-сценарии, также присваивается уникальный идентификатор (он уникален на время жизни объекта), т.е. PHP повторно использует Объекты в PHP не были приняты сообществом программистов без споров, и сообщения типа Зачем мне нужны эти объекты? часто раздували флеймы на форумах и в списках рассылки.Стало очевидным, что объекты ведут себя не так, как объекты в других объектно Рис. 1. Переменные объявляются при помощи типа, объекты - при помощи класса. Так же как может существовать много переменных одного и того же типаЗадания для самостоятельного решения. Лабораторная работа 5. Объекты и классы в PHP. Класс как тип данных. Для инициализации объекта используется оператор new для инстанциации объекта в переменной.Смотрите также: Описание на ru2.php.net Описание на php.ru.Типы графики. Создание объектов в PHP. Вы можете создать объект класса с помощью ключевого слова new, следующим образомТеперь, когда мы знаем, как создавать классы и объекты PHP, давайте рассмотрим добавление свойств. Существует 3 типа свойств, которые можно добавить в класс Создание объектов в PHP. Вы можете создать объект класса с помощью ключевого слова new, следующим образомТеперь, когда мы знаем, как создавать классы и объекты PHP, давайте рассмотрим добавление свойств. Существует 3 типа свойств, которые можно добавить в класс Еще одним новшеством в объектной модели в PHP 5 является указание типов ( type hinting). В самом языке PHP использование типов не предусмотрено.Исключения подчиняются иерархии объектов, как и любой другой класс в PHP. EG(scope) относится к типу zendclassentry. Это класс, которому принадлежит запрашиваемый вами метод.Да, ладно, ещё в 2003 году я активно использовал объекты в PHP 4. И в книгах по PHP объекты были. С помощью функции printr() можно вывести содержимое объекта, как и в случае с массивами. Свойства и методы.Типы данных. Константы. Получение и установка типа переменной. Операции в PHP. pickle new stdClass pickle->type fullsour Обсуждение Точно так же, как функция array() возвращает пустой массив, создание объекта типа stdClass предоставляет объект без свойств и методов.Вернуться в раздел: PHP / 7. Классы и объекты. Абстрактный класс в php - это так называемый базовый класс, не предназначенный для создания его экземпляров ( объектов).Существует еще один тип абстрактного класса интерфейс. Интерфейс это абстрактный класс, который содержит только абстрактные методы. Объекты и классы в PHP. В этой лекции мы рассмотрим объектную модель, предлагаемую языком PHP.В одной из первых лекций мы упоминали о существовании в PHP такого типа данных, как объект. Главная » Изучение PHP » Типы данных языка PHP » Объекты (Object). Объекты (Object). Объект является одним из базовых понятий объектно-ориентированного программирования. В PHP5 если создаются две равные переменные типа объект, то они указывают на одно значение и изменяются одновременно (мы приводили похожий пример с переменными строкового типа). Объявление объекта класса несколько отличается от объявления переменной. Следует помнить, что благодаря слабой типизации объявлять переменные и уточнять их тип в PHP вообще не требуется, переменную можно ввести в любой момент Определение типов объектов в объектно-ориентированном программировании на PHP.Поэтому объект ShopProduct относится к элементарному типу object, а также к типу класса ShopProduct. PHP: Классы и объекты. Определение класса. Создание объекта.Хотя функционально они идентичны (т.е. пусты) obj1 и obj2 - это два разных объекта одного типа, созданных с помощью одного класса. Класс также можно рассматривать как тип данных (см. главу 2), а объект -- как переменную (по аналогии с тем, как переменная counter относится к целому, а переменнаяСледует помнить, что PHP также позволяет явно получить значение атрибута указанием имен объекта и атрибута Объекты в PHP. Используются во всех функциях, где ответом является проверка на отсутствие или наличие чего-либо, например, функция для определения есть ли цифры в тексте или их нет.Смешанные типы данных. Массивы (Array). Объекты (Object). Классы и объекты (PHP 4).Список поддерживаемых транспортных протоколов. Таблица сравнения типов в PHP. Список меток (tokens) парсера. ООП: уточнение типа класса. Обработка исключений. Reflection API.В PHP 5 возможна перегрузка доступа к свойствам объектов. Так как PHP написан на языке С, который строго типизирован, то перед разработчиками встала задача разработать такой тип данных, который бы удовлетворил ВСЕОбъекты. В целом, объект представляет из себя набор переменных (zval), и функций, а также описания класса. Объекты. В одной из первых лекций мы упоминали о существовании в PHP такого типа данных, как объект. Класс это описание данных одного типа, данных типа объект. классы являются как бы шаблонами для реальных переменных.

Проще говоря, класс — это тип данных, а объект — сущность типа класс. Пример класса и объекта в PHPВ данном примере переменная MyClass является объектом типа MyClass. К чему все эти премудрости? Возвращает тип PHP-переменной var. Для проверки типа переменной используйте функции is.isobject() - Проверяет, является ли переменная объектом. Developer.Roman.Grinyov.Name. Способы создания объектов в PHP. С помощью директивы new?> С помощью указателя типа:

Популярное: